Abstract

A process for preparing cephalosporins of the structure: ##STR1## where R is any of hydrogen, C.sub.1 to C.sub.4 alkyl, t-butoxy, benzyloxy, cyano-methyl, thienyl-methyl, furyl-methyl, naphthyl-methyl, phenyl-methyl, phenoxy-methyl, phenoxy-isopropyl, pyridyl-4-thiomethyl and tetrazolyl-1-methyl; PA1 R.sub.1 is any of hydroxyl, C.sub.1 to C.sub.4 alkoxy, benzyloxy, p-methoxy- (or nitro-) benzyloxy, benzhydryloxy, triphenylmethoxy, phenacyloxy, p-halophenacyloxy and trichloroethoxy; PA1 Z is any of hydrogen, hydroxyl, --O--CO--C.sub.1 -C.sub.4 alkyl, --O--C.sub.1 -C.sub.4 alkyl, --Br, --I, --Cl, --N.sub.3, --NH.sub.2, --O--CO--CH.sub.3, --O--CO--NH.sub.2 and an -S-mononuclear nitrogen heterocyclic ring, PA1 By reacting compounds of the structure: ##STR2## IN WHICH R, R.sub.1, and Z are as above defined; R.sub.2 and R.sub.3 are the same or different and represent a C.sub.1 to C.sub.4 alkyl, a mononuclear aryl ring, --CN, a mononuclear heterocyclic ring or the radicals --COR.sub.4, COOR.sub.4, --PO(OR.sub.4).sub.2, --CO--NHR.sub.4 or R.sub.2 and R.sub.3 together may represent: ##STR3## where T represents >CH.sub.2, -N--R.sub.4 ; and R.sub.4 is lower alkyl, a mononuclear aryl ring or a…
